This tourney which features only those going to the World Cup and just top 10 teams with the #1 USA, #4 England, #8 Japan & #10 Brazil kicks off Feb. 27 with the US facing Japan in Chester PA, the home of the Union in the second game as the first is at 4 when England & Brazil clash. Brazil, France & the USA comprise 3 of only 7 teams to have been in the last 7 World Cup Tourneys. Those with local ties include from RVC, Crystal Dunn, Kelley O'Hara former Sky Blue Star & Carli Lloyd of NJ & Sky Blue who had 2 soccer clinics this weekend in Syosset.

readThe Whitecaps and Canadian international Marcel De Jong have mutually agreed to part ways, having appeared in 46 games overall for the team. 'Cap HC Marc Dos Santos had this to say, "We are thankful to Marcel for his contributions." In his 2 plus years with the team he had 6 assists. He has been with teams in a few nations including the academy for Holland powerhouse PSV Eindhoven, in Germany with Augsburg, Ottowa of the NASL in Canada and MLS side Sporting KC.
